00问答网
所有问题
当前搜索:
byte数组转为string
byte
类型怎么
转换成String
类型?
答:
将byte数组转换成string方法如下
BASE64Encoder enc=new BASE64Encoder();String 转换后的string=enc.encode(byte数组);将byte数组转换成stringBASE64Encoder
enc=new BASE64Encoder();String 转换后的string=enc.encode(byte数组);将string转换回来成为byte数组:BASE64Decoder dec=new BASE64Decoder();t...
java里面
byte数组
和
String
字符串怎么
转换
答:
1、string 转 byte[]String str = "Hello"
;//声明一个字符串 byte[] srtbyte = str.getBytes();//使用string类的getBytes方法进行转换 2、byte[] 转 string byte[] srtbyte;//声明一个byte字节数组 String res = new String(srtbyte);//使用构造函数转换成字符串 System.out.println(res);...
java中
byte数组
怎么
转换成string
类型
答:
可以用String的构造方法String(byte[] bytes,int offset,int length),或者普通的构造方法String(byte[] bytes)
,用法如下:public class ByteArrayToString {public static void main(String[] args) {byte[] bytes=new byte[]{'a','b','c','d','e','f','g'};byteArrayToString(bytes,n...
c#
byte数组转string
答:
首先要先知道你的byte数组是基于什么编码方式生成的,然后才能根据这种编码方式转回
string
例:byte[] bytes = System.Text.Encoding.UTF8.GetBytes("要
转换成byte数组
的字符串");//这里根据utf-8的编码形式将字符串转换成byte流,如果想转换回正确的字符串,也必须是utf-8的编码,否则转换成功也是乱码...
byte数组
怎么
转成string
答:
1.Convert.ToBase64
String
与 Convert.FromBase64String 此方法简单实用。
转换成
的
string
包含:26个英文字母的大小写、+、/、0~9的数字,总共64个字符。一般会在结尾出现“=”。分析其原因很简单。原理:用64个字符来描述6bit的二进制。方式:把
byte
数据连在一起,以6bit为单位进行分组,使用64个字符...
java里面
byte数组
和
String
字符串怎么
转换
答:
byte数组转换成String
可以调用String的参数为byte数组的构造方法,代码如下:String res = new String(byte);String转换成byte数组可以调用String的getByte方法,代码如下:byte[] srtbyte = str.getBytes();
c#vyte[]
转换
到
string的
长度是一样的吗?
答:
byte数组是最原始和单纯的字节数据,而
string
是字节数据在一定编码条件下的组合,所以对于不同的编码格式,同样的
byte数组转换
后得到的string不仅内容不一样,而且长度也会不一样.给你个简单例子,下面的代码:byte[] b = new byte[] { 0x78, 0x90, 0x12, 0x45, 0x78, 0x33 };Console.WriteLine("...
如何把
byte数组转换成string
答:
1、string 转
byte
[]java">String str = "Hello";byte[] srtbyte = str.getBytes();2、byte[]
转 string
java">byte[] srtbyte;String res = new String(srtbyte);System.out.println(res);3、设定编码方式相互转换 java">String str = "hello";byte[] srtbyte = null;try { srtbyte...
java里面
byte数组
和
String
字符串怎么
转换
答:
字符串是有一个个的字符组成的,字符
数组
就是字符串,因此,JDK提供了如下转换方法:1. byte[]
转换成String
:String str= new String(byte[]
bytes
);2. String转换成byte[]:byte[] data
Array
="Hello World!".getBytes();以上便是jdk的String工具类提供的转换方法。
byte数组转为
字符串
String的
两种方式的区别?
答:
其实还有别的方法。你说的第一种是用
byte数组
初始化一个
string
对象,是可以的,第二种不能实现预期效果是因为buffer是一个对象,它的默认的toString()方法并不是将它
转为
字符串返回,而是返回它的类型名称,即system.byte。如果想让第二种方法实现你的效果,需要重写toString方法。另外可以通过Encoding类...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
byte数组转string的几种方法
怎么把byte数组输出为字符串
java字节数组转string
c将byte数组转换为string
java中byte转string
怎么把byte转化为string
http会讲byte数组转String
byte字节转换String
new byte数组